What Is a Dental Bridge?
A dental bridge is a prosthetic device that fills the gap left by one or more missing teeth. It consists of artificial teeth (pontics) that are supported by natural teeth or dental implants. Bridges help maintain the shape of your face and distribute bite pressure evenly, preventing remaining teeth from shifting out of place.

Types of Dental Bridges We Offer
At Auburn Dental Center, we provide several types of dental bridges, depending on your specific dental needs:
- Traditional Bridges – The most common type, supported by dental crowns on adjacent natural teeth.
- Implant-Supported Bridges – Attached to dental implants instead of natural teeth for added stability.
- Cantilever Bridges – Used when only one adjacent tooth is available for support.
- Maryland Bridges – A conservative option that uses a metal or porcelain framework bonded to the back of adjacent teeth.
The Dental Bridge Procedure
The process of getting a dental bridge typically involves the following steps:
- Initial Consultation – Our dentist evaluates your oral health and discusses the best bridge option for your needs.
- Tooth Preparation – If a traditional bridge is chosen, the adjacent teeth are reshaped to support dental crowns.
- Impressions and Temporary Bridge – Digital impressions are taken to create a custom bridge, and a temporary bridge is placed to protect the area.
- Permanent Bridge Placement – Once the final bridge is ready, it is adjusted for a perfect fit and cemented into place.
For those missing multiple teeth, an implant-supported bridge may provide a more secure and long-term solution.

Caring for Your Dental Bridge
With proper care, dental bridges can last 10–15 years or longer. To maintain your bridge:
- Brush and floss daily, using a floss threader or water flosser to clean under the bridge.
- Avoid chewing hard foods or using your teeth to open packaging.
- Visit us regularly for dental cleanings and exams.
- Maintain a healthy diet to protect the surrounding teeth and gums.
Frequently Asked Questions
- How long does a dental bridge last?: With good oral hygiene and regular dental visits, a dental bridge can last 10–15 years or more.
- Does getting a dental bridge hurt?: The procedure is typically painless, as we use local anesthesia to ensure comfort. Some mild sensitivity may occur after the procedure but usually subsides quickly.
- Can a dental bridge be replaced?: Yes, if a bridge becomes worn or damaged, it can be replaced with a new one. Routine check-ups help monitor the condition of your bridge.
- What is the difference between a dental bridge and a dental implant?: A dental implant is a standalone tooth replacement secured into the jawbone, while a bridge relies on adjacent teeth or implants for support. Our dentist will help determine which option is best for you.
